Given fractions are 2405/351,4621/748
To find the GCF of fractions, we have to find the GCF of numerator numbers and LCM of denominator numbers. Its formula is given by
GCF of Fraction = Greatest Common Factor of Numerator/Least Common Multiple of Denominators
In the fractions 2405/351,4621/748, numerators are 2405,4621
Denominators are 351,748
The GCF of 2405,4621 is 1 .
LCM of 351,748 is 262548.
The greatest common factor of 2405/351,4621/748 = [GCF of 2405,4621]/[LCM of 351,748]= 1/262548
Therefore, the GCF of 2405/351,4621/748 is 1/262548.

2. What is the GCF of a fraction?
The GCF of a fraction is defined as the greatest fraction that divides exactly into 2 or more fractions.
3. How to find GCF in Fractions?
Answer: GCF of fractions can be found using the simple formula GCF of Fractions = GCF of Numerators/LCM of Denominators.
